Summary

Education
Dr. Enders teaches approximately three courses per year to medical fellows in the Mayo Graduate School's Clinical and Translational Sciences program. These typically include a first and second course in introductory statistics and regression, as well as an upper level course. Dr. Enders was awarded the Health Sciences Research Distinguished Teaching Award in 2006. Dr. Enders' personal research focuses on statistics education for nonstatisticians; her most recent efforts in this area surround the use of Calibrated Peer Review to help students better interpret linear regression coefficients. Other interests include study designs appropriate for statistics education and methods for assessing agreement.

Evaluation
Dr. Enders serves as the Chair of the Evaluation Committee for the Mayo Clinic Center for Translational Science Activities' (CTSA) educational resource component. This program requires detailed specialized followup of a variety of students (PhD, MS, Certificate, and research coordinator) to assess outcomes and evaluate program success.

Collaborative Research
Dr. Enders collaborates with the Mayo Division of Gastroenterology and Hepatology. This relationship includes an ongoing clinical trial on the use of high dose ursodeoxycholic acid for the treatment of Primary Sclerosing Cholangitis, as well as a wide variety of smaller projects.
